WebStomach pain, loss of appetite, intestinal upsets, sleep disturbances and loss of energy are all common symptoms of acute grief. Of all life's stresses, mourning can seriously test your natural defense systems. Existing illnesses may worsen or new conditions may develop. Profound emotional reactions may occur. WebIt is important to note that for some employees, duties at work can provide structure and normalcy that promotes healing and acceptance in the grieving process. The workplace may provide a time to set aside the emotions and struggles of coping with the loss. WebGrief in the workplace has serious symptoms that can affect productivity and employee engagement. Some of the symptoms are: Not being able to focus on daily tasks. A lack of motivation for doing your job. Difficulty with making decisions. Feeling confused or forgetful. Worrying about other family members or finances. Lowered energy levels.
